How do you make UV resistant?

UV resistance of plastics is usually achieved by the use of additives such as UV stabilizers, black coloration (typically using carbon black) or protective surface coatings (such as paint, or metallization). The addition of carbon black is a low cost and typically very effective way of creating UV resistant plastics.

What protects the paint by reflecting UV light?

By absorbing sunlight instead of letting it reach the polymer, UV absorbers protect the coating. … These products typically change the energy from UV radiation into heat. UV absorbers transmit the absorbed energy through radiating the heat.

Does paint block UV rays?

Paint is by far the best because it contains the elements that best block both UV light and water. The pigment blocks the UV light and the film thickness blocks water penetration.

Does polyurethane degrade in sunlight?

Organic (urethane or polyurethane) products are not and break down in sunlight. This is because UV does not have enough energy to cleave the SI-O, silicone bond. However, C-C bonds used in organic materials are very unstable. UV weathering is the main cause of sealant degradation.

Is polyurethane good for outdoors?

Most exterior polys can be used indoors, but interior polys should never be used outdoors; they lack the additives that protect exterior finishes from UV rays.

Is varnish UV resistant?

A variant of varnish known as spar or marine varnish offers both UV protection and flexibility, which makes it a favorite among DIY woodworkers, who can confidently apply it to soft woods like pine that bend under extreme conditions.

Is 2K clear coat better than 1K?

The significant difference between 1K and 2K clear coat is the need for a catalyst to dry. 1K can dry without any additives, whereas a 2K clear coat needs a catalyst to harden. Otherwise, it won’t fully dry. … 2K clear coat spray cans providers a far superior level of protection.

Which is better 1K or 2K paint?

1K – suited to interior use, low traffic areas, and places less prone to general wear and tear. 2K – suited to exterior use, heavy use areas, high temperature surfaces and other harsh environments.

What car color fades the fastest in sunlight?

So why does red fade more than other paints? It’s because wavelengths associated with red are the lowest energy of visible light, so to appear red it’s absorbing much more energetic wavelengths, which causes more aggressive degradation of the paint’s molecular bonds. This is in addition to what UV rays are doing.

Does acrylic absorb UV?

Most acrylic plastics will allow light of wavelength greater than 375 nm to pass through the material, but they will not allow UV-C wavelengths (100–290 nm) to pass through. Even very thin acrylic sheets of less than 5 millimeters (mm) do not let UV-C light penetrate.

Is epoxy paint UV resistant?

Once cured, epoxy is moisture resistant. Epoxy is not, on its own, UV resistant. Some epoxies have a UV resistant additive added to them that works moderately well. However, the best way to ensure that your epoxy doesn’t yellow or breakdown from UV rays is to top coat it with clear UV resistant urethane.

What is UV gloss coating?

Gloss/High Gloss UV coating consists of applying a varnish to standard printing product and then sealing it with UV light. As a result, the colors are enhanced and the product looks glossy. Additionally, it makes the gloss paper more resistant to any external element which may damage the ink or quality.

What is matte UV coating?

Matte is a flat satin finish that doesn’t show fingerprints and makes colors appear more vibrant. UV Coating can be reflective and glossy and has a high solids level that allows the coating to be applied in very thin films.

Will paint protect plastic from UV rays?

Answer: Ultraviolet (UV) radiation would be more harmful to acrylonitrile-butadiene-styrene (ABS) used outdoors than the heat and cold. Therefore, it should be coated with a pigmented material (paint) for UV protection.
